Key Points

  • The institute is the pioneer of the Co-op programs (Cooperative Education) in Engineering in India. This model of education is followed in US, Canada and German Universities.
  • Through the Co-op program, students are able to alternate academic study with full-time employment, gaining practical experience in their fields of study.
  • An expert advisory board of eminent academicians from diverse fields is constituted by the college for supervision. The council consists of esteemed members from premium institutions like IIT Delhi, IIT Kharagpur and Stanford University.
  • LIET also has academic collaborations with leading industry experts like IBM, Oracle, Microsoft, AWS Academy.
  • The college has  30+ Industry Collaboration, 10+ Global Academic Certifications with some of the leading organisations.
  • Academic collaborations with reputed universities/ colleges around the world, including Pennsylvania State University (USA), Buckingham University (UK), Tribhuvan University (Nepal), ELCOP (Bangladesh) and University of Colombo (Sri Lanka) has been established by the college.
  • The co- partners of Lloyd Institute of Engineering and Technology includes Skilancer Solar, Vehant, Xerpa, Socio Charge, Alchemist and many more.

Admission Procedure

The institute offers a BTech programme in five specialisations. Admission to the same is entirely based on JEE Mains score. 

BTech Admission 2021

At the UG level, Lloyd Institute of Engineering and Technology offers a BTech programme with a duration of four years. Admission to the BTech programme is entrance-based, and candidates are selected based on their JEE Main score. A few important highlights for the same are shown below. Placements

Lloyd Institute of Engineering and Technology co-op programs give a great boost to the college placements. LIET offers a stellar academic experience to students and aims to bridge the gap between academia and industry. The college boasts job assurance for all of its students as it has established a strong industry connection.

Career Guidance Training & Placement (CGPT) cell undertakes various activities of training and grooming of students in terms of conducting mock interviews, GD sessions, resume writing workshops, HR meetings etc. Along with providing placement assistance to students of B.Tech program, placement cell also helps in managing industry interactions and industry relations. It has forged good relationships with many reputed companies in the field of Engineering and Technology.

Scholarships

LIET provides scholarships to students who come from diverse economic backgrounds. The scholarships are given only to those students who have enrolled into any of the UG courses of the college. The criteria for selection is based on an online examination for which the students have to register online.

The scholarship details are tabulated below:

Ranking Scholarship % (concession on tuition fees only)
1 100% + Macbook pro
2 90% + IPad Air
3 80% + INR 25000 Cash
Top 10% 40%
Top 11% to 20% 35%
Top 21% to 30% 25%
Top 31% to 40% 10%
